Don Bosko launched with pooja ceremony

The film is being produced by Loukya Entertainments and Sree Maya Entertainments

BH Harsh

Loukya Entertainments, that has produced films like Colour Photo and Bedurulanka 2012, launched their new production titled Don Bosko, with a muhurtham pooja ceremony on Friday. The ceremony was attended by Naga vamsi, the Laila producer Sahu Garapati and Chukkapalli Suresh, among others.  

Loukya Entertainments is producing the film in collaboration with Sree Maya Entertainments, with Ravindra Banerjee and Sailesh Rama serving as producers. The makers also released a poster on the occasion, which showcases the characters’ photos pinned on a ‘Most Wanted’ board at a police station. The poster also has the tagline, ‘Welcome to the Class Reunion - Batch 2014. Not all Reunions are about memories; some are about redemption.’

Don Bosko is being written and directed by Shankar Gowri. Rushya, Mirnaa Menon and Mounika will be seen in lead roles in the film. While Murali Sharma plays the role of a Principal, the supporting cast also includes Vishnu Oi, Mounika, and Rajkumar Kasireddy.

Mark K Robin is the music director for the film. Garry BH is the editor, and Pranay Naini is the art director. Cinematography is by Eduroluraju.
